WebTerbium concentration in the earth’s crust is 1.2 ppm, and the element is found in minerals including cerite, gadolinite, bastnaesite, monazite, xenotime, and euxenite. The method of extraction of the element is based on the same procedure as mentioned in the case of the previous lanthanides, and after the separation of insoluble cerium using HNO 3 , terbium …
